I did it both for aesthetics and to avoid having to carry a spare for the trailer (though it seems unlikely I'd flat an all-terrain on a lightweight trailer). Also because I love the Gen1 Montero wheels. Also so I can rotate around all six since the trailer will NEVER wear these out and eventually I'll have to replace them just because of being too old.

incidentally, no adaptors. my trailer is homebuilt frame with a 3500# trailer axle (built to the length I wanted it to fit the wheels correctly) with 6-lug trailer hubs that fit the wheels.

Most of your counter points are value judgments and my intention was not to imply there is something wrong with how you decide to equip your vehicle.
The paragraph I quoted is a misinterpretation of what I posted. I absolutely think trailer brakes are practical. My point was that trailer brakes are smaller than most truck brakes and don't need the same wheel clearance. A taller tire sidewall rather than larger diameter wheel will be lighter and have more give before denting the wheel. Trailer wheels also don't really benefit from the stiffness of lower profile tires because they aren't used to steer the vehicle into corners.
Again, we are kind of splitting hairs here and it's not like one choice will be vastly superior to another.

I don't think I was misinterpreting, I think I did a poor job of expanding upon the topic. I should have moved my line of thought into a new paragraph or post :) We agree on the practicality of brakes. FWIW, the 3500lb trailer brakes on my trailer are very nearly the same size as the rear brakes on my Tacoma. I definitely could have gotten by with smaller brakes on my trailer, these ones will easily lock up if I run the controller too high.

I run what is likely thought of as a smallish tire (235/85R16) but it works well for me and the type of traveling that I do. I have no complaints about running the same tire on the trailer, though I do run it at a slightly lower pressure since the trailer is on the lighter side for the tire's load rating.

I'm no expert on this, but have researched running truck rims on a trailer allot, and should have copied the quotes Ive found.. But the sentiment remains in my mind that at least three others (reported) have had bearing failures because of to much offset. To much offset tries to twist the wheel on the bearings instead of even force up.


"Wheel offset is the distance from the mounting surface to the centerline of the tire. Dexter Axle bearing sets are designed for wheels with 0 to 1/2" inset. Exceeding this offset will shorten bearing life and may lead to dangerous bearing failure."

My truck rims have about 2 1/4" of positive offset, so I would have to run 2" spacers to get 1/4" of positive offset.

The best way to understand or figure out offset vs back space (two completely different measurements) is to draw it on paper.. When you calculate backspace, a rim is actually about 1" wider than it's size. So an 8" wide wheel measures 9" for backspace purposes.
